About the role

  • As a Quantitative Developer / Research Engineer, you will be an early member of the team with meaningful ownership of its systems, research tooling, and engineering practices.
  • You will work closely with experienced researchers and trading-system engineers across the team and the firm, combining substantial autonomy with strong technical mentorship.
  • You will work at the intersection of quantitative research and software engineering, turning research ideas into reliable systems that trade.

Responsibilities

  • the team has the opportunity to design its technology and research platform from the ground up while benefiting from DRW's capital, data, compute infrastructure, market access, and institutional experience.
  • Engineers are not a support function-they are central to how we conduct research, put strategies into production, and build a lasting competitive advantage.
  • Work closely with quantitative researchers to implement studies, test hypotheses, and translate promising ideas into robust production systems
  • Build reliable data infrastructure for large historical and real-time datasets, with an emphasis on point-in-time correctness, reproducibility, performance, and ease of use
  • Build from an early stage - Help shape a new systematic trading business, with broad scope, short feedback loops, direct influence over how the team operates, and the opportunity to share in its success

Requirements

  • A bachelor's, master's, or PhD degree in computer science, computer engineering, or another technical field
  • At least two years of experience developing production software, primarily in Python and/or C++, with the ability and willingness to work across languages when needed
  • A track record of scoping and delivering production systems in fast-moving or ambiguous environments
  • Experience in trading or finance is not required.
  • We have also leveraged our expertise and technology to expand into three non-traditional strategies: real estate, venture capital and cryptoassets.
  • Strong computer science fundamentals and sound instincts in software design, debugging, testing, and performance analysis
  • The ability to enter an unfamiliar system, develop a clear mental model of it, and identify practical ways to improve its reliability, simplicity, and performance
  • Fluency in a UNIX/Linux environment and a working understanding of operating systems, concurrency, networking, and system performance
  • High ownership, good judgment, and a bias toward action-you identify risks early, reduce unnecessary complexity, and take pride in building systems that others rely on
  • Clear communication and a collaborative working style, particularly when working across research and engineering disciplines
  • Experience in trading or finance is not required. We value strong engineering and problem-solving ability and will provide the domain-specific training needed to succeed.
